Warning Signs You Need Stucco Water Damage Repair

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Our team is here to help you identify and address these issues quickly.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show water damage or mold growth. Don't ignore these smells, as they can lead to health issues and further damage.

Stains or Discoloration

Unusual stains or discoloration on your stucco exterior can be a sign of water damage. Addressing these issues quickly can pr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Cracks in the Stucco

Cracks in the stucco can allow water to seep in, causing further damage. Our team can assess and repair these cracks to prevent water damage.

Water Stains on the Ceiling

Water stains on the ceiling can show water damage or leaks in the roof. Our team can help you identify and address these issues.

Peeling or Flaking Stucco

Peeling or flaking stucco can be a sign of water damage or poor installation. Our team can assess and repair these issues to ensure a durable finish.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as warped or buckled stucco, can show a serious issue. Our team can help you address these problems quickly.

Stucco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or cracks in the stucco Yes No DIY repairs can be effective for minor cracks.
Water stains on the ceiling No Yes Professionals can identify and address underlying issues.
Visible water damage No Yes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s and health hazards.
Stucco repair after a storm No Yes Professionals can assess and address potential structural issues.
Peeling or flaking stucco No Yes DIY repairs can exacerbate the issue, leading to further damage.
Water damage from a roof leak No Yes Professionals can identify and address underlying issues with the roof.

Stucco Water Damage Repair Cost In Lightfoot, VA

The cost of stucco water damage repair var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lightfoot, VA.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on the specifics of your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Minor crack repair $500 - $2,500 Size of the crack, material used
Water stain removal $1,000 - $5,000 Size of the stain, underlying damage
Stucco repair after a storm $2,000 - $10,000 Severity of the damage, size of the affected area
Peeling or flaking stucco repair $3,000 - $15,000 Size of the affected area, material used
Water damage from a roof leak $5,000 - $20,000 Severity of the damage, size of the affected area
Custom stucco repair $10,000 - $50,000 Size of the affected area, material used
